Living in North Platte, Nebraska means long drives and a crowded high school. The new $29 million high school building, completed in 2003, has a capacity of 1,600 students - expandable to 2,000. Despite the investment, overcrowding persists, with the district noting the school site is "severely congested." And bureaucracy is a persistent headache, with multiple failed bond initiatives over the decades to address the issues. For those willing to brave the distance and hassle, North Platte may be a fit, but it's not for the faint of heart.
